Ducks In the Pond

8/16/10

Around and around
I go spinning in circles
How could I forget?

The way forward comes
It startles me every time
Looking backwards now

It was November
I was making lists, again
Planning for the trip

Looking at a pond
Small ducklings were lining up
Following mother

Mine are all full grown
It was my time to wander
But it has been hard

Now they are circling
Finding their way in the world
I am missing them

I know they are strong
But still needing some support
I want to go home
 
_________________________
11/26/07

I wait for the ducks
Lining up in the still pond
Which direction now?

The waiting is hard
Self-doubt challenging me now
Numb feet take small steps

Breathing in and out
I challenge the cold, dry, cough
Far across the pond

The mist curls my hair
Shakey self-esteem rattles
The bones are fragile

I have learned to see
Life's obstacles repeating
Pushing back the fear

I hand it over
To the "inner duck" swimming
Slowly, but surely
